Corrugated Iron: A Durable and Cost-Effective Roofing Solution
galvanized steel presents a budget-friendly covering option renowned for its durability and reduced price . This versatile material is commonly seen in both private and business construction due to its ability to withstand harsh elements, including storms and strong winds . Besides, its uncomplicated installation procedure contributes to noticeable decreases in work expenses , making it a popular choice for contractors and property owners alike .

Protecting This Home: A Look to Ceiling Covering Durability
To improve the duration of your roof sheeting, consider several key factors. Annual assessments are vital to detect any early signs of damage. Fix breaches quickly, as they can result in extensive structural problems. Adequate breathing below the roof sheeting is also critical for reducing humidity build-up, which can promote mildew expansion and shorten its working duration. Finally, opt for durable roofing products that are ideal for your location and financial plan.
